Divine Fury is a passive talent in the Priest Holy tree in the recorded Forever demo.

Ranks

Descriptions below preserve the source wording. Rank labels describe the source evidence; they are not independent gameplay verification.

Rank Effect Evidence
1 Reduces the casting time of your Smite, Holy Fire, Heal and Greater Heal spells by 0.1 sec. Unconfirmed / estimated
2 Reduces the casting time of your Smite, Holy Fire, Heal and Greater Heal spells by 0.2 sec. Unconfirmed / estimated
3 Reduces the casting time of your Smite, Holy Fire, Heal and Greater Heal spells by 0.3 sec. Unconfirmed / estimated
4 Reduces the casting time of your Smite, Holy Fire, Heal and Greater Heal spells by 0.4 sec. Unconfirmed / estimated
5 Reduces the casting time of your Smite, Holy Fire, Heal and Greater Heal spells by 0.5 sec. Unconfirmed / estimated
